A small group of individuals leave a larger population and colonize a new area that is physically separated from the original population. Due either to chance or genetic drift, the genetic composition of the new colony differs from the larger population. This is an example of  Random drift.

Random drift is caused by recurring small population sizes, severe reductions in population size called "bottlenecks" and founder events where a new population starts from a small number of individuals.

The process in which frequency of alleles within a population change by chance alone as a result of sampling error from generation to generation. is called Genetic drift. It is a random process which may lead to large changes in populations over a short period of time.

Explanation:

Because the frequency of allele  doesn't change in any predetermined direction, we also call genetic drift "random drift" or "random genetic drift." The genetic composition error may occur due to the following conditions;

1)A small number of individuals, representing only a small parts of the total genetic variation in a species, started a new population, a founder effect occurs . A founder event occurs when one or two infected plants slip through a quarantine and introduce a disease into an area where the disease did not previously exist.

2)Small recurring population size occurs when there are not many host plants in the area to infect, or when the environment is not optimal for infection.

3) A severe reduction in population size or genetic bottleneck occurs when the plant population is removed (e.g. harvest of the crop), or when the environment changes to prevent infection of the plant or to kill the pathogen directly (e.g. periods of hot, dry weather or a deep freeze).

Which disappears more rapidly from a population, a deleterious dominant allele or a deleterious recessive allele?
Allisa [31]

Answer:

Selection is a directional process that leads to an increase or a decrease in the frequency of genes or genotypes. Selection is the process that increases the frequencies of plant resistance alleles in natural ecosystems through coevolution, and it is the process that increases the frequencies of virulence alleles in agricultural ecosystems during boom and bust cycles.

Selection occurs in response to a specific environmental factor. It is a central topic of population and evolutionary biology. The consequence of natural selection on the genetic structure and evolution of organisms is complicated. Natural selection can decrease the genetic variation in populations of organisms by selecting for or against a specific gene or gene combination (leading to directional selection). It can increase the genetic variation in populations by selecting for or against several genes or gene combinations (leading to disruptive selection or balancing selection). Natural selection might lead to speciation through the accumulation of adaptive genetic differences among reproductively isolated populations. Selection can also prevent speciation by homogenizing the population genetic structure across all locations.

Selection in plant pathology is mainly considered in the framework of gene-for-gene coevolution. Plant pathologists often think in terms of Van der Plank and his concept of "stabilizing selection" that would operate against pathogen strains with unnecessary virulence. As we will see shortly, Van der Plank used the wrong term, as he was actually referring to directional selection against unneeded virulence alleles.
